Does Samsung A12 have a Secure Folder?
Every Samsung phone, including the Galaxy A12, has the “Secure Folder” feature. You can use the secure folder to protect your private photos, messages, apps, contacts, files, etc., from being accessed by others. It’s a great way to save and protect sensitive data on your phone.
Where is Samsung Secure Folder located?
Your Secure Folder will be available for you to use like any other Android app on your device. Look for the Secure Folder app shortcut on your phone’s home screen or in its app drawer.

How do I view a Secure Folder?
You can easily move files in and out of Secure Folder using the Share via menu option.
- Select file(s) > Tap Share > Choose Secure Folder.
- Unlock Secure Folder (User Authentication). If Secure Folder is unlocked, the Secure Folder share sheet will be shown immediately.
- Choose an app to share in Secure Folder.

Is Samsung Secure Folder safe?
Apps and data in Secure Folder are sandboxed separately on the device and gain an additional layer of security and privacy, thus further protecting them from malicious attacks.
How do you create a Secure Folder?
On your device, follow these instructions:
- Go to Settings > Lock screen and security > Secure Folder.
- Tap Start.
- Tap Sign in when asked for your Samsung Account.
- Fill in your Samsung account credentials. …
- Select your lock type (pattern, pin or fingerprint) and tap Next.

How do I disable s secure apps?
Go to Secure Folder > tap More options (three vertical dots). Step 2. Tap Settings > switch off Show icon on Apps screen to deactivate it. Alternatively, swipe down the Quick panel, and then tap Secure Folder to deactivate the feature.
